Finance Review — Westmoor Expansion

Entry into the Westmoor region is projected to require 1.2m in year one, with breakeven in month nineteen. Staffing, leasing, and logistics assumptions were stress-tested against a slower demand case. Currency exposure is modest and hedged quarterly. The confidential element of the expansion plan appears below.

board note of kafog-bajep: Briathek Partners is in early talks to buy Aldaelek Group for about $47.1 million. The Ulaath launch date is September 4, and nothing goes to the press before then.

Welcome to on-call for Ledgerbird! Heads up: the payments integration suite gets flaky whenever the sandbox processor (Finchpay) resets its nightly fixtures. If you see a wall of red around 02:00, rerun before panicking. To reproduce locally you'll need the sandbox test environment wired up, which most failures trace back to anyway. Copy the team .env template, then add the sandbox credential on its own line:

env line for yajep-bajof: ARCHIVE_KEY3=015

## 4.2.1 — Changed defaults

Vernhouse Controller now compensates for humidity-sensor drift automatically. Recalibration interval dropped from 72h to 24h, and drift tolerance tightened. Growers on older probes may see more frequent calibration prompts; this is expected. No action needed unless alarms persist past two cycles. The shipped defaults are now set to the values below.

settings of kawif-tawig:
[pelok]
port = 5432
region = lower-3
host = pelok.crelvocorp.example
team = fraox
timeout_ms = 750
retries = 7